MEETING NOTES — DISPATCH BRIEF, KESTRAL RIDGE SITE

Attendees: T. Maro, L. Fennick.

Spare parts for the pump array at Kestral Ridge: two impellers, one gasket kit, valve seals. Crated and strapped by stores; weight under 40 kg. Weather window closes Thursday, so parts go out Wednesday on the Orvane Freight shuttle. Dispatch desk to stage crate at bay 2 by 06:00, paperwork taped inside the lid. No substitutions without Fennick's sign-off. The hand-over instruction for the courier follows on the next line.

courier memo of yahif-faweg: the quenael tamius courier leaves the prawyn jorix kaswyn istox silmir brieth zormir fenvan ledger at gate 3145 under passcode 231062

Runbook 12.4 — Leased Laptop Returns, Quarrow Systems. Office manager: collect all end-of-lease units by Wednesday noon. Wipe confirmation must be logged per device before boxing. Use the padded return crates only; max ten units per crate. Courier pickup is Thursday morning from the ground-floor store, not reception. Crates must be sealed and counted against the return manifest before release. No loose chargers outside the crates. The courier hand-over instruction appears below.

dispatch memo: the eliath belael courier leaves the praox ledger at gate 8841 under passcode 017589

Management Meeting Minutes — Revised Commission Scheme

Attendees: Orla Fenwick (Chair), Dev Maraston, Pia Skoll.

1. Current scheme at Quillbrook Ltd deemed unsustainable; overpayments in the Harrowgate territory noted.
2. Revised model: 4% base, accelerators above quota, caps removed for enterprise deals.
3. Rollout targeted for next quarter, pending payroll system changes.
4. Incoming director to brief regional leads personally.
5. Transition payments to be honoured for one cycle only.

The related business note is recorded below.

management briefing: Project Ulavan slips by two quarters because of the staffing delay.

## Runbook: Dedupe Customer Records

Every few weeks the Larkspur import job leaves duplicate customers behind — usually same email, different casing. Run the `dedupe_sweep` script, review the merge candidates it prints, then confirm with `--apply`. Don't skip the review step; merges are irreversible. The script needs direct access to the customers database, so point it at the connection string below.

primary connection of yagep-kahip = redis://giliel_svc:zYiKsLL2PLpfPL@db-348f.xolmarsys.corp:5432/fenwyn